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 10C, Waldegrave Road, we estimate a market value of £413,909 and a rental value of £1,826 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£366,605 and £1,618 per month respectively.
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 10C, Waldegrave Road completed on 9th February 2007 at £168,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a leasehold flat.
Since 1995 this is the property's only sale.
Values of comparable properties have risen by 61.3% over the period since February 2007.
